"Baby Come Home" is a 2012 song by British post-grunge band Bush from their fifth album The Sea of Memories. It was released as the third single on 17 January 2012.[1]

Music video[edit]

The music video was directed by Gavin Rossdale's brother-in-law Todd Stefani. It is available on Bush's VEVO account.[2]
